This is very sad news - he always seemed to be in the thick of the action as far as progressive British jazz was concerned and truly bridged the gap between the Tracey/Hayes generation and Stevens/Watts etc. I'll spin that 'Springboard' LP today in recognition of one of the 'Best of British'. RIP First Ian Carr and now, Jeff Clyne passes on. What a truly dreadful couple of years for jazz RIPs from this land.
